Product details

Overview

BZA862AL,115 from Nexperia is a quadruple ESD transient voltage suppressor diode in SOT353 (SC-88A) package with common anode configuration, 6.2 V nominal working voltage (IZ = 1 mA), ≤105 pF capacitance at 0 V, and 15 W non-repetitive peak reverse power dissipation for 1 ms pulses - deployed for high-speed data line protection in USB, HDMI, and audio interfaces.

For engineers reviewing the BZA862AL,115 datasheet, BZA862AL,115 pinout, BZA862AL,115 application, or BZA862AL,115 equivalent, key selection criteria include clamping performance under IEC 61000-4-2 ±8 kV contact discharge, low diode capacitance for signal integrity, thermal resistance to solder point (185 K/W, all diodes loaded), and common-anode 5-pin layout for compact 4-line ESD suppression.

Technical Context

The BZA862AL,115 integrates four monolithic Zener-based ESD protection diodes sharing a single anode terminal (Pin 2), enabling simultaneous clamping of four independent signal lines to ground. Its design targets fast transient response with <50 ns clamping delay and low dynamic impedance (≤300 Ω differential resistance at 1 mA).

It operates within a junction temperature range up to 150 °C and exhibits a positive temperature coefficient of 1.6 mV/K for stable voltage regulation across operating temperatures. The device is rated for 2.1 A non-repetitive peak reverse current (tp = 1 ms) and supports continuous forward current up to 200 mA per diode.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Working Voltage (VZ) 5.89–6.51 V at IZ = 1 mA; ensures reliable clamping above logic-high thresholds while staying below IC absolute maximum ratings.
Reverse Current (IR) ≤500 nA at VR = 4 V; minimizes leakage-induced signal distortion or battery drain in always-on interfaces.
Diode Capacitance (Cd) ≤105 pF at f = 1 MHz, VR = 0 V; preserves signal integrity on high-speed lines (e.g., USB 2.0, I²C).
Non-repetitive Peak Power (PZSM) 15 W for tp = 1 ms; withstands IEC 61000-4-2 ESD events without degradation.
Differential Resistance (rdiff) ≤300 Ω at IZ = 1 mA; limits clamping voltage rise under surge current, improving protection margin.
Thermal Resistance (Rth j-s) 185 K/W (all diodes loaded); enables effective heat dissipation through Pin 2 (common anode solder point) on standard PCBs.

Pinout & Package

SOT353 (SC-88A) surface-mount plastic package: 1.3 mm × 2.2 mm × 1.15 mm body, 0.65 mm pitch, 5 leads, gull-wing terminations. Mounting optimized for minimal parasitic inductance in ESD paths.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1 Cathode 1 ESD clamp path for first protected signal line; connects to I/O trace before connector.
2 Common Anode Shared anode tied to system ground; primary thermal conduction path and reference node for all four diodes.
3 Cathode 2 ESD clamp path for second protected signal line; electrically isolated from Cathode 1.
4 Cathode 3 ESD clamp path for third protected signal line; maintains independent clamping behavior.
5 Cathode 4 ESD clamp path for fourth protected signal line; enables compact 4-line protection in single footprint.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
IEC 61000-4-2 ESD Rating >8 kV contact discharge - meets industrial and consumer immunity requirements without external circuitry.
Low Capacitance Architecture 105 pF max per diode - avoids signal attenuation or timing skew on 10–480 Mbps interfaces.
Common-Anode Quad Configuration Single ground connection (Pin 2) simplifies PCB layout and reduces return-path inductance vs. discrete diodes.
Thermal Performance 185 K/W Rth j-s (all diodes active) - sustains repeated ESD events without thermal runaway on standard FR4.

Applications

USB 2.0 Interface Protection HDMI DDC/CEC Line Protection

Use Scenario: Protecting D+ and D− data lines plus ID and VBUS sense lines in portable USB hosts and peripherals against electrostatic discharge during hot-plug events.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Passive clamping diode array providing sub-ns response to ±8 kV ESD transients while maintaining <100 pF loading on 480 Mbps differential pairs.

Use Value: Eliminates need for four separate SOT23 diodes, reducing board area by >60% and minimizing ground loop inductance via shared anode.

Use Scenario: Safeguarding HDMI Display Data Channel (DDC) and Consumer Electronics Control (CEC) bidirectional lines connected to display panels and source devices.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Low-capacitance quad suppressor placed at HDMI connector to clamp transients before reaching level-shifting or buffer ICs.

Use Value: Prevents latch-up or permanent damage to HDMI PHYs with 6.2 V working voltage aligned to 5 V rail tolerance and 105 pF loading compatible with 100 kHz DDC signaling.

Audio Codec Line Protection Industrial I²C Sensor Bus

Use Scenario: Shielding analog and digital audio interface lines (e.g., I²S, S/PDIF, MIC bias) in smartphones, headsets, and smart speakers from user-handling ESD.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Quad ESD suppressor applied to left/right channel, ground reference, and microphone bias lines with minimal signal distortion.

Use Value: 500 nA reverse leakage at 4 V prevents DC offset errors in analog audio paths; 1.3 V forward voltage allows safe operation with 1.8 V/3.3 V codec I/Os.

Use Scenario: Hardening multi-drop I²C buses connecting temperature, pressure, and humidity sensors in factory automation controllers and PLC modules.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Common-anode suppressor protecting SDA, SCL, and two auxiliary control lines (e.g., ALERT, RESET) from field-induced transients.

Use Value: 300 Ω differential resistance ensures clamping voltage stays below 7 V during 2.1 A surge, preserving I²C logic levels and preventing bus lockup.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ar ESD suppression appl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
ESD5V3U4-2/TR Lower working voltage (5.3 V typ), higher capacitance (130 pF), same SOT353 package and common-anode topology. Better suited for 3.3 V systems with tighter voltage margins; less ideal for 5 V tolerant interfaces due to earlier clamping onset. Select when clamping must activate below 5.5 V and system tolerates higher capacitive load.
TPD2E001DRYR Higher ESD rating (±15 kV air/±8 kV contact), lower capacitance (10 pF), but uses different pinout (Pin 2 = GND, not common anode) and requires separate ground routing. Superior for ultra-high-speed interfaces (e.g., PCIe, USB 3.0), but increases PCB complexity due to non-common-anode layout. Choose for next-gen designs requiring <15 pF loading and highest IEC immunity; avoid if reusing legacy BZA862AL,115 layout.

Compared with ESD5V3U4-2/TR and TPD2E001DRYR, the BZA862AL,115 delivers balanced performance for cost-sensitive 4-line 5 V interfaces - offering proven 6.2 V clamping, 105 pF loading, and simplified grounding without sacrificing IEC 61000-4-2 compliance.

FAQ

What is the maximum clamping voltage of the BZA862AL,115 during an 8 kV IEC 61000-4-2 ESD event?

The BZA862AL,115 does not specify a single maximum clamping voltage in its datasheet, but measured waveforms in Figure 6 show clamped ±1 kV ESD pulses at ~12 V peak for BZA862AL under IEC 61000-4-2 test conditions. Actual clamping depends on PCB layout inductance and current rise time; typical clamping voltage at 2.1 A peak current is estimated at ≤14 V based on VZ + I × rdiff. The BZA862AL,115 achieves this with no external components.

Can the BZA862AL,115 be used to protect 3.3 V logic lines without risk of false triggering?

Yes - the BZA862AL,115 has a minimum working voltage of 5.89 V at IZ = 1 mA, well above the 3.3 V rail, ensuring no conduction during normal operation. Its 500 nA reverse leakage at 4 V further guarantees negligible loading. The BZA862AL,115 is routinely applied to 3.3 V I²C, SPI, and UART lines where overvoltage transients-not steady-state voltage-trigger clamping.

Is the BZA862AL,115 RoHS compliant and halogen-free?

Yes - as a Nexperia product manufactured post-2017, the BZA862AL,115 conforms to RoHS Directive 2011/65/EU and is halogen-free per IEC 61249-2-21. The SOT353 package uses lead-free matte tin plating and green molding compound. Compliance documentation is available via Nexperia's product change notifications and material declarations.

How does the thermal resistance of the BZA862AL,115 affect its reliability in repeated ESD events?

The BZA862AL,115 specifies Rth j-s = 185 K/W when all four diodes are active - meaning a 15 W, 1 ms pulse raises junction temperature by ~2.8 °C above solder point. This low thermal resistance prevents cumulative heating during burst-mode ESD testing. The BZA862AL,115 maintains stable clamping performance across >1000 repetitive 8 kV discharges when mounted per recommended layout guidelines.

Does the BZA862AL,115 require external current-limiting resistors in series with protected lines?

No - the BZA862AL,115 is designed for direct placement between signal line and ground with no series resistor required. Its 200 mA continuous forward current rating and 4 A non-repetitive peak forward current (IFSM) accommodate typical ESD surge currents. Adding series resistance would degrade clamping speed and is unnecessary unless system-level analysis indicates excessive steady-state current in fault conditions.
